Accounting & Tax Matters specialises in individual & small business returns.
Julie Morrison has been providing taxation & accounting services on the Fraser Coast since 2007. Julie has a Bachelor of Business (Major in Accounting) & a Graduate Diploma of Taxation from Central Queensland University. She is a CPA (Certified Practicing Accountant), a Tax Agent & a Justice of The Peace. Julie was born in Maryborough and has lived in the area her whole life except three years when she was in Rockhampton for University study and seven years gaining professional experience on the Gold Coast.
